The European Company Statute (SE) Gives Companies Operating in More Than One Member State The Possibility to cross-border reorganized Their Business Under one European label. This Enables Them to Work Within a stable legal framework, internal Reduce the Costs of Operating in Several Countries and hence more competitive Be In The Internal Market. The SE Has Proved To Be In Some very popular Member States aim It Has Not Taken off in others. In order to determine whether exchanges are needed to make the SE Statute Better work, the European Commission Has Launched a public consultation. With The review of the SE Statute, the Commission IS Aiming to Increase the Use of the SE across the European Union. The study and the consultation Under the SE Regulation, the Commission required to carry it IS ITS practical application five years after entry Into force STIs and to put forward amendments WHERE appropriée. Reasons to be a solid Factual Basis for the postponement, the Commission Launched year external study in December 2008, Which the views of stakeholders are now intéressée Sought. Responses Will Be Taken Into account in the Commission's forthcoming Report on the SE, Which Will Also Be complemented by a high-level conference on 26 May 2010. The deadline for responses to the consultation IS 23 May 2010.
